I dis-connected the intercooler pipe at the top, behind the radiator....easiest one to get to.
The line has a film of Oil in it?
Is this normal?
169k miles and original piping.
Pulls hard...good pressure etc...

Thin film is normal. When you start to get gobs in there and it begins to leak from the weep hole in the bottom of the intercooler, that's when it's time for a new turbo.
